Administrative Coordinator
- Robert Half Office Team (New York, NY)
-
Description We are looking for an experienced Administrative Coordinator to support the Offices of the President and Vice President of Development in New York, New York. This is a Contract position requiring a proactive and detail-oriented individual who thrives in an executive office environment. The ideal candidate will handle a variety of administrative tasks with a high level of confidentiality and attention to detail, contributing to the smooth operation of the organization.
Responsibilities:
• Manage scheduling needs, including donor meetings and follow-ups, ensuring all calendar entries are accurate and timely.
• Coordinate internal and external meetings by organizing participant attendance, arranging room and IT setups, ordering catering, and preparing necessary materials.
• Organize bi-monthly All Staff meetings by creating agendas, collecting and compiling presentation materials, and overseeing catering, IT, A/V, and room arrangements.
• Prepare for monthly Leadership meetings, including confirming attendance, drafting agendas, and taking detailed minutes for distribution.
• Arrange travel for the President, including booking accommodations, preparing itineraries, creating briefing documents, and managing reimbursements.
• Provide administrative support for the Vice President of Development, such as scheduling meetings, coordinating outreach, and handling travel arrangements.
• Process monthly expense reports and invoices, ensuring accurate and timely submissions.
• Execute special projects as assigned by the President’s Office and Vice President of Development.
• Maintain a high level of discretion and confidentiality when managing sensitive information. Requirements • Minimum of 3-5 years of experience supporting C-suite executives in a detail-oriented environment.
